klUSING A'TRIPOD: R.4,•V1 '4,`Of ' , • . A tripod can be screwed into the tripod socket. When using the 50mm or 70mm telephoto lens or the 2040mm zoom lens, the lens will hit the tripod mount. To correct this, screw the accessory tripod spacer onto the tripod mount before affixing the camera. 36 • I:1%16f • I N. Corrective eyepieces can be mounted on the viewfinder window by inserting over the accessory grooves. These are available in the following diopters: -5, -4, -3, -2, -1, +1, +2 and +3. When purchasing a corrective eyepiece, make certain it is the right one by testing it on a camera. 1" ( T C11H'/11- 11' 1 37
